The Alamosa Solar Generating Plant is a 35.3 MWp (30.0 MWAC) concentrator photovoltaics (CPV) power station, the largest in the world when it was completed, in May 2012. It is currently the world's third largest operating CPV facility. The output is being sold to Public Service of Colorado, a subsidiary of Xcel Energy, under a long term Power Purchase Agreement.
Read more on WikipediaAlamosa Solar is a 30 MW solar photovoltaic power plant located in Alamosa County, Colorado. The plant, which began operating in 2012, is owned and operated by Solar of Alamosa LLC. It utilizes a single generator with dual-axis solar tracking technology. Alamosa Solar is interconnected to the Public Service Company of Colorado balancing authority within the Western Electricity Coordinating Council (WECC) NERC region.
In its most recent year of operation, Alamosa Solar generated 35,133 MWh of electricity, achieving a capacity factor of 13.4%. The plant ranks 25th out of 177 power plants in Colorado and 1276th out of 7108 plants nationally. Financial data indicates that Alamosa Solar has a power purchase agreement (PPA) price of $35 per MWh.
